"Powerizers" Won Yesterday

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

The "Powerizers" defeated the "Merry Maidens" in the Leiter Cup games yesterday by the score of 17 to 6. The result of the "Craigie Halls" and "Air Tights" game was not reported last night. On Friday the "Importers" won from the "Garbage Inspectors' Union" by default. One game remains to be played in the preliminary series, the scheduled contest not being played Friday. The "Indoor Yacht Club" will meet the "Nom de Bums" on the second team field this afternoon at 4 o'clock.
